Caio Cabral
29db5ec50a
refactor: changing the fetch for the infrastructure monitor
2024-11-27 21:24:04 -05:00
Caio Cabral
fd278d3a97
feat: abstracting table pagination
2024-11-27 17:38:39 -05:00
Shemy Gan
aa6e881c1a
Merge branch 'develop' into 1067-fe-hardware-monitoring-create-hardware-monitor
2024-11-14 11:03:38 -05:00
Alex Holliday
02b797244e
Add docker type to uptime slice
2024-11-13 15:33:18 +08:00
Shemy Gan
63cb4e7f1d
- Add basic joi validation to match what's available in BE
...
- Extract/ refactor the custom alert section to its own function
- WIP UI added custom alert section, retain log section and maxreties in advaced setting section
- Extend Field component to accomodate for custom alert narrower text field
2024-11-06 11:13:02 -05:00
Shemy Gan
ffeb4d7991
- Add initial create infrastructure page
2024-10-31 15:19:57 -04:00
Shemy Gan
42ae1af987
- Add infrastructure monitor slice
2024-10-31 10:36:09 -04:00
Alexander Holliday
9e26a0d9ba
Merge pull request #1072 from aarya-16/develop
...
Added User theme(Light/Dark) preference detection
2024-10-28 20:07:32 +08:00
aarya-16
7a559977ca
Shifted mode ternary to a variable
2024-10-28 17:03:52 +05:30
aarya-16
0c3d8245e9
Theme preference logic moved to UISlice
2024-10-27 20:33:33 +05:30
Alex Holliday
5d9b8bf051
remove some testing code accidentally committed
2024-10-25 09:58:11 +08:00
Alex Holliday
47946cbf34
Uncomment out expect statement
2024-10-24 10:04:22 +08:00
om-3004
9c0a2b5f35
Seperate check resolution for Page Speed Monitors
2024-10-19 11:05:36 +05:30
om-3004
34a13530b3
Merge branch 'develop' into enhancement/check-if-url-resolves
2024-10-18 11:39:07 +05:30
om-3004
d61a41fd95
Update the api endpoint from /check-endpoint/url to /resolution/url
2024-10-17 10:18:12 +05:30
Alex Holliday
15ab9f8bc8
Format all files with prettier config for baseline
2024-10-17 12:05:06 +08:00
om-3004
ebf6a0ceb7
Check the monitor URL resolution before adding it
2024-10-15 17:20:54 +05:30
Alex Holliday
7b65debed6
Populate table
2024-10-04 15:25:41 +08:00
Alex Holliday
ca30dcc33c
set default url to empty string
2024-09-30 14:58:20 +08:00
Alex Holliday
6268b2573c
remove jwtSecret from settings
2024-09-30 11:14:53 +08:00
Alex Holliday
5c4d094da7
update settings
2024-09-27 12:13:39 +08:00
Alex Holliday
488ba717ac
Add advacned settings page
2024-09-27 10:55:37 +08:00
Alex Holliday
179e95eefe
add redux state for settings
2024-09-26 16:18:25 +08:00
Alex Holliday
0791c7e5c5
Fix typos
2024-09-22 12:17:34 +08:00
Alex Holliday
1c8376dc24
Refactor network service to use config objects for clarity
2024-09-22 11:38:42 +08:00
Alex Holliday
afa5cf1fc0
Implement setting TTL on FE
2024-09-16 12:13:29 +08:00
Alex Holliday
40076e1772
add timezone to UI slize
2024-09-12 11:36:22 +08:00
Alex Holliday
c35157ffb4
Add thunks for adding and removing demo monitors
2024-09-11 12:03:13 +08:00
Alex Holliday
cca41fe6df
Update pagespeed redux store
2024-09-05 13:25:19 -07:00
Alex Holliday
0487095d05
Updated uptime redux state
2024-09-05 12:47:27 -07:00
Alex Holliday
9eaab0da1a
Add network requests and validation
2024-09-05 12:16:29 -07:00
Alex Holliday
adf75b701a
Pagespeed fixes
2024-09-04 22:51:00 -07:00
Alex Holliday
789e6e91c4
add thunks for getting pagespeed monitor
2024-09-03 12:07:59 -07:00
Daniel Cojocea
263fed4ff6
Added greeting lists and implemented randomizer
2024-09-02 02:31:43 -04:00
M M
b376786f5b
Small spelling error fix.
2024-09-01 10:02:20 -07:00
Alex Holliday
13039ed2ff
Add thunk and network methods
2024-08-30 09:47:11 -07:00
Alex Holliday
bddca58a37
Merge branch 'develop' into fix/colorful-revamp-extravaganza
2024-08-29 16:12:40 -07:00
Alexander Holliday
5c2d89018f
Merge pull request #749 from bluewave-labs/feat/pause-monitors
...
Add pause routes and controller, implement functionality
2024-08-29 16:02:27 -07:00
Alex Holliday
43dff00cd6
Use axios directly for fetching file
2024-08-29 12:58:32 -07:00
Alex Holliday
4d78163121
Implement pausing
2024-08-29 12:17:37 -07:00
Daniel Cojocea
111501156f
Fixed pages rerendering on sidebar state change
2024-08-29 02:19:19 -04:00
Alex Holliday
d4ed7f3f7a
Add thunks for getting single monitor and pausing/resuming single monitor
2024-08-28 20:07:22 -07:00
Daniel Cojocea
aca350495a
Added barebones theme toggle
2024-08-28 22:14:55 -04:00
Alex Holliday
3220d15a35
Update pagespeed to use teamId
2024-08-28 10:31:37 -07:00
Alex Holliday
c8c2dfe9ec
Rename thunks to reflect teamId vs userId
2024-08-27 12:07:30 -07:00
Alex Holliday
465c1f9f9e
Refactor getMonitorByUserID to getMonitorByTeamID
2024-08-26 19:38:24 -07:00
Daniel Cojocea
af31c564cd
Added more tables to track
2024-08-20 18:40:03 -04:00
Daniel Cojocea
689f74bf11
Added docs and fix to tooltip hover
2024-08-20 17:34:54 -04:00
Daniel Cojocea
1419b20591
Added action to change rows per page
2024-08-20 17:27:07 -04:00
Daniel Cojocea
c379348581
Added toggle sidebar action
2024-08-20 17:18:02 -04:00